BRIP1/FANCJ Monoclonal specifically detects BRIP1/FANCJ in Human samples. It is validated for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in), Immunoprecipitation, Western Blot.

Specifications

Antigen BRIP1/FANCJ
Applications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in), Immunoprecipitation, Western Blot
Classification Monoclonal
Clone pp15-IB4
Conjugate Unconjugated
Dilution Western Blot 1:500-1:1000, Immunoprecipitation 1:10-1:500
Formulation Ascites with 0.05% Sodium Azide
Gene Accession No. Q9BX63
Gene Alias ATP-dependent RNA helicase BRIP1, BACH1BRCA1/BRCA2-associated helicase 1, BRCA1 interacting protein C-terminal helicase 1, BRCA1-associated C-terminal helicase 1, BRCA1-binding helicase-like protein BACH1, BRCA1-interacting protein 1, BRCA1-interacting protein C-terminal helicase 1, EC 3.6.1, EC 3.6.4.13, FANCJFanconi anemia group J protein, FLJ90232, MGC126521, MGC126523, OF, Protein FACJ
Gene Symbols BRIP1
Host Species Mouse
Immunogen A peptide corresponding to the C-terminus of human FANCJ (within amino acids 1200-1249). [SwissProt# Q9BX63]
Molecular Weight of Antigen 130 kDa
Purification Method Unpurified
Quantity 0.025 mL
Regulatory Status RUO
Research Discipline Breast Cancer, Cancer, Chromatin Research, DNA Double Strand Break Repair, DNA Repair, Genes Sensitive to DNA Damaging Agents
Primary or Secondary Primary
Gene ID (Entrez) 83990
Target Species Human
Content And Storage Store at 4C short term. Aliquot and store at -20C long term. Avoid freeze-thaw cycles.
Form Ascites
Isotype IgG1 κ
